Personal Data and Biodata of Eric Hernandez (Drummer)
Attribute | Detail |
---|---|
Full Name | Eric Hernandez |
Known As | Eric Hernandez (Bruno Mars' brother) |
Born | 1976 |
Birthplace | Brooklyn, New York, USA |
Profession | Drummer |
Band | The Hooligans (Bruno Mars' band) |
Father | Peter Hernandez (percussionist for Love & Money and Cecilio & Kapono) |
Siblings | Jaime Kailani, Tiara Hernandez, Bruno Mars (Peter Gene Hernandez), Tahiti Hernandez, Presley Hernandez |
Notable Performances | 2014 Super Bowl Halftime Show with Bruno Mars and Red Hot Chili Peppers |
Start of Drumming | Age 4 |
Professional Debut | Age 10 (in Hawaii) |
Current Role | Drummer for The Hooligans |
Early Life and Musical Roots
Born in 1976 in Brooklyn, New York, Eric Hernandez's destiny with rhythm seemed almost preordained. His father, Peter Hernandez, was a seasoned percussionist who had played with notable bands like Love & Money and Cecilio & Kapono. This familial immersion in music provided a fertile ground for young Eric to develop his talents. It's often said that music runs in the family, and for the Hernandez clan, this couldn't be truer.
His drumming journey began remarkably early, at the tender age of four. This early start allowed him to internalize rhythms and techniques long before many children even pick up an instrument. The family's move to Hawaii, a vibrant cultural melting pot, further enriched his musical exposure. By the age of 10, Eric was already playing professionally in Hawaii, a testament to his innate talent and dedication. This early professional experience undoubtedly shaped his discipline and stage presence, preparing him for the grand stages he would later command.
A significant turning point in the family's life occurred when Bruno Mars was a preteen: his parents divorced. Following this, Eric and his younger brother, Peter Gene Hernandez (who would later become known as Bruno Mars), went to live with their father, Peter. This period likely fostered an even stronger bond between the brothers and deepened their shared connection to music, guided by their father's professional insights and experiences.

Super Bowl Halftime Show: The Global Stage
One of the most high-profile moments in Eric Hernandez's career, and indeed for The Hooligans, was their performance at the 2014 Super Bowl Halftime Show. This event is one of the most-watched musical performances globally, offering unparalleled exposure. Eric joined Bruno Mars on stage, delivering a high-octane performance that captivated millions. The show was memorable not just for Mars' electrifying presence but also for the band's tight musicianship, with Eric's drumming providing the driving force.
Adding to the spectacle, the performance also featured a collaboration with the legendary Red Hot Chili Peppers. Eric Hernandez even posted photos with the iconic Red Hot Chili Peppers drummer, Chad Smith, a moment that surely resonated with drumming enthusiasts worldwide. This interaction highlights Eric's standing among his peers and the respect he commands within the drumming community. The Super Bowl performance solidified The Hooligans' reputation as a world-class live band and showcased Eric's ability to perform under immense pressure on the biggest stage imaginable.
The Renowned Musical Hernandez Family
The story of Eric Hernandez is inextricably linked to his family, a truly "renowned musical family." Beyond his father, Peter Hernandez, who laid the groundwork, Eric is one of six siblings, many of whom are involved in music in various capacities. The siblings include Jaime Kailani, Tiara Hernandez, Bruno Mars (Peter Gene Hernandez), Tahiti Hernandez, and Presley Hernandez.
